China's cold storage chain is facing the severe global competition at the present time, and the cooling transportation is the bottleneck of the cold storage chain. As convenient operation and lower cost, the cooling transportation thus has more space to develop. Yet, in the cooling transportation, by using the phase-changed material to keep cool, there are problems such as obvious unevenness of temperature distribution, shorter cooling time, no perfect method of cargo quality assessment, etc. There are not much research documents and technical data for practical use in China and overseas. This thesis takes the whole cooling transportation without inner thermal source as the study subject, analyzes the affection to the cooling effect from all the factors in the cooling transportation. The purpose is to establish the optimizing temperature managing system in the cooling transportation. That would bring the theoretical meaning and practical value to China's cooling transportation.By considering the affection to the cargo temperature value and the temperature distribution from all the factors inside the cooling container, the thesis try to establish the relations between the cargo's average temperature and the unevenness of temperature, propose the assessment method that may comprehensively reflect the cargo's cooling effects, offer useful search for seting up the assessment system of the cooling transportation.Taking the assessment method of the cooling effect as the theoretical base, it had established the outer temperature prediction model of the geographical locations when cargo moving in every time units, and the average temperature prediction model of the cargo inside the phase-changing material container. It raised the prediction method of the optimizing usage amount of the phase-changed material in the cooling transportation. This method may avoid the waste and high cost of the phase-changed material in the cooling transportation, or insufficient using amount of phase-changed material that may cause the cargo rotten and not able to guarantee the cargo's quality in the limited temperature scope. The effects of the cooling transportation will be economically improved.Finally it conducted a temperature managing method in the cooling transportation, that included the using prediction of the phase-changed material before the transportation, the whole temperature monitoring and controlling in the transportation, the effective feedback of the temperature and preparing the data table after the end of the transportation, and put them into the practical use. This method improved the traditional managing method that only caring on the starting and finishing points, but not the whole transportation process. It has the significance for ensuring the cargo's quality, lowering the loss of the easy-rotten goods, saving energy and improving the service of the forwarders.The above works will have the obvious theoretical meaning and practical value for perfecting the cooling transportation system, improving the cargo's quality, lowering the energy consumption, and will benefit the sustainable development of China's cooling transportation industry.
